Transaction 3c58c790809ef20810a7b0fd29995ac7968090c95c6889b81f3fc818be61b17f
1 Input
2 Outputs
- 3c58c790809ef20810a7b0fd29995ac7968090c95c6889b81f3fc818be61b17f:0
- 3c58c790809ef20810a7b0fd29995ac7968090c95c6889b81f3fc818be61b17f:1
value 2613487
address 1QD2FzeNh2yLLRcoyByVgxPdQB4yAW96Sm
value 5436277
address 1MegevsoB7Jhmg47AS145H3iUr6rQHGxLt